The verdict

The draft-tier duel at $0.05 versus $0.04. Standalone, Vidu wins: faster and marginally cheaper for identical jobs. Gen-4 Turbo's case is contextual — if you're already in Runway for Gen-4.5, Turbo shares the wallet and workflow, and that integration outvalues a cent per second. Rule: your finishing tier decides your draft tier.

Whichever you pick, apply a retake multiplier before budgeting: the model that gets your specific shot right in fewer attempts is often the cheaper one in practice, regardless of sticker price. Full tier breakdowns: Gen-4 Turbo pricing and Vidu 2.0 pricing.
